I am looking for information to help us layout a fire protection system for a commercial site.  In particular information on locating FDC with regard to backflow prevention, PIV, etc.

Be sure to check the local municipality's regulations.  They can be more stringent than NFPA.

A side note.  In the area of Florida I live in the fire protection design is considered a specialty and the S&S PE must be competent in the area.  We (or the architect) usually sub out the design of the system to a certified fire suppression contractor.  My design typically ends at a stubbed out valve from the main.
